The Cultural Tapestry in Religious Pilgrimages
Pilgrimage, a treks undertaken for spiritual reasons, has woven itself into the fabric of human civilization for centuries. From the ancient trails trodden by devotees to sacred sites like Mecca, Varanasi, and Santiago de Compostela, pilgrimage offers a profound expression of faith and cultural uniqueness. These journeys, often fraught with hardship, are deeply entrenched in traditions that differ significantly across belief systems. Through rituals, ceremonies, and acts of worship, pilgrims seek to connect with the divine, find purpose in their lives, and forge a sense of community. The cultural tapestry made up by religious pilgrimages is a testament to the enduring human desire to seek transcendence and connection.
